The Soviet Woman is a seminal work by revolutionary thinker Alexandra Kollontai, one of the foremost female leaders of the early Soviet era. In this influential book, Kollontai examines the lives, struggles, and contributions of women in Soviet society, addressing issues of labor, family, marriage, and political participation.

Combining personal observation, political analysis, and advocacy for gender equality, Kollontai highlights how revolutionary changes reshaped women’s roles and challenged traditional patriarchal norms. The text remains a foundational study of women’s emancipation in socialist societies and continues to inspire feminist thought today.
